Key Qualifications:

  • Proficiency in American Sign Language (ASL) and other relevant sign systems
  • Experience as a Sign Language Interpreter, especially in educational settings
  • Knowledge of Deaf culture and accessibility best practices
  • Ability to adapt interpreting style to suit diverse students and situations
  • Strong collaboration and communication skills for working with teachers, staff, and families
  • Valid certification or licensure per state and school district requirements

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Interpret spoken language into sign language and vice versa for students, educators, and parent meetings
  • Support students’ understanding and participation in classroom activities, assemblies, and school events
  • Foster an inclusive environment that respects and encourages communication access for all
  • Collaborate with special education teams, offering insight into student needs and accommodations
  • Maintain confidentiality, professionalism, and adherence to ethical guidelines at all times
